A very cool self serve system in this bar, I would recommend to anyone visiting Prague. I was very careful with the pour but ended up with an outrageous amount of creamy, foamy head, easily four fingers worth.
It eventually settled and started to show its pale yellow body, semi transparent with mild catbonation.
Scents are damp, muted cereal, virtually indistinguishable at first before some sweet bread and dry cracker shine through and a light corn note brings some sweetness to the end.
Mouthfeel is very dull, what little carbonation there was is suffocated by the foam that cascades through then disappears.
Taste is strong, sweet doughy bread. Yeast is very prominent, dominant even. Some cracker 'cracks' through before the a bitter malt spike finishes everything and starts the aftertaste.
A experimental lager that, while I was happy to try, I would not buy again.
